![]() ![]() Now let’s see how one can print series till the position mentioned: This function can be called by specifying any position. Here “fibonacci_num” is a function defined, which takes care of finding the Fibonacci number with the help of certain conditions.Python Code for finding nth Fibonacci NumberĪs one can see, the Fibonacci number at 9 th place would be 21, and at 11 th place would be 55. However, you can tweak the function of Fibonacci as per your requirement but see the basics first and gradually move on to others. Let’s see the implementation of Fibonacci number and Series considering 1 st two elements of Fibonacci are 0 and 1: One can use any other IDE or Ipython notebooks as well for the execution of the Python programs. For demo purpose, I am using spyder, an IDE for the Python programming language. If not, it would be great if one can revise it and then take up the coming content. One should be aware of basic conditioning statements like the loop, if-else, while loop, etc., in Python before proceeding here. Let’s see the implementation of the Fibonacci series through Python. However, Python is a widely used language nowadays. When it comes to implementing the Fibonacci series, there could be a number of coding languages through which it could be done. Where nth number is the sum of the number at places (n-1) and (n-2). However, In terms of mathematical rule, it can be written as: So, now you know all the major ways to create this series using methods ranging from Recursion to Matrix and Backtrasing.Looking at the above, one would have got a certain idea about what we are talking about. We discovered how to write a Python program to print Fibonacci series as well as get the nth number of the Fibonacci series. This blog covered everything about the Fibonacci series in Python. This is the function to print the nth Fibonacci number in Python using a Power Matrix and Time Optimization. Fibonacci Series Code in Python Using Power Matrix and Time Optimization ![]() We can now move on to the function to print the nth Fibonacci number in Python using a Power Matrix. Fibonacci Series Code in Python Using Power Matrix Time Complexity: O(logn) because calculating phi^n takes (log n) timeĩ.Let’s take a look at the function to print the nth Fibonacci number in Python using Binet’s formula. Fibonacci Series Code in Python Using Binet’s Formula Mentioned below is the function to print the nth Fibonacci number in Python using the Top-to-Bottom approach. Fibonacci Series Code in Python Using Top-to-Bottom Approach Memo = fibonacci(p-1, memo) + fibonacci(p-2, memo)ħ. Let’s now see the function to print the nth Fibonacci number in Python using the Backtrasing approach. Fibonacci Series Code in Python Using Backtrasing Approach Return fibonacci(number - 1) + fibonacci(number - 2)Īlso Read: OOPS Concepts in Python 5. Then we update it by switching the variables, and the process continues.īelow is the code to print the Fibonacci Series program in Python. This happens if there are more than two terms in the given series. Using a while loop, we can find the next term in the Fibonacci series by adding the previous two terms. In the program to print the Fibonacci series in Python, the method stores the number of terms specified by the user and initializes the first and second terms to 0 and 1 respectively. If you want to master this most popular programming language in the 21st century, consider pursuing a Python course. In mathematical terms, a Fibonacci series is defined using a recurrence relation. The Fibonacci series can go on forever till infinity if the formula is applied to each number. The sum of integers 5 and 8 adds up to 13. For example, the first two numbers before the eighth number, 13, are 5 and 8. Starting with the third integer, each number follows the formula. According to the rule, each number present in the Fibonacci series is equal to the sum of two consecutive numbers present before it. The Fibonacci sequence in Python is a collection of integers that begins with a zero. Fibonacci Series in Python: Print the nth Number. 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|